Per day production = 3000
The capacity of the warehouse = 50000
Current count of trinkets = 8000
Part 1:
Assuming that no trinkets are going to be shipped out,
The equation for the number of trinkets T in the warehouse after D days:
![T=8000+3000D](https://img.qammunity.org/2020/formulas/mathematics/middle-school/uqxvxf1920d6xx0evjatjn09un9otudj34.png)
Part B:
We will put T=50000 in above equation.
![50000=8000+3000D](https://img.qammunity.org/2020/formulas/mathematics/middle-school/lwlhygz7w1y0y53dza7igdm9bkdz0wjhj5.png)
=>
![3000D=50000-8000](https://img.qammunity.org/2020/formulas/mathematics/middle-school/eepl0jt5un8em3d8v59c2a7hcn5ud7fs18.png)
=>
![3000D=42000](https://img.qammunity.org/2020/formulas/mathematics/middle-school/zf0bh8hlvo7qg4otintd68wbpb0ly8fzgm.png)
D = 14
Hence, it will take 14 days to fill the warehouse.
